Algert Global LLC Grows Holdings in TTM Technologies, Inc. (NASDAQ:TTMI)

TTM Technologies logo with Computer and Technology background

Algert Global LLC raised its holdings in TTM Technologies, Inc. (NASDAQ:TTMI - Free Report) by 137.5% in the second quarter, according to its most recent 13F filing with the Securities & Exchange Commission. The firm owned 218,938 shares of the technology company's stock after purchasing an additional 126,748 shares during the period. Algert Global LLC owned approximately 0.21% of TTM Technologies worth $4,254,000 at the end of the most recent quarter.

A number of other institutional investors have also recently bought and sold shares of TTMI. CWM LLC boosted its holdings in TTM Technologies by 202.6% in the 2nd quarter. CWM LLC now owns 1,858 shares of the technology company's stock valued at $36,000 after purchasing an additional 1,244 shares during the period. Headlands Technologies LLC bought a new stake in TTM Technologies in the 1st quarter valued at about $37,000. Innealta Capital LLC bought a new stake in TTM Technologies in the 2nd quarter valued at about $64,000. EntryPoint Capital LLC boosted its holdings in TTM Technologies by 108.1% in the 1st quarter. EntryPoint Capital LLC now owns 6,264 shares of the technology company's stock valued at $98,000 after purchasing an additional 3,254 shares during the period. Finally, Mackenzie Financial Corp acquired a new position in shares of TTM Technologies in the 2nd quarter valued at approximately $225,000. Institutional investors own 95.79% of the company's stock.

TTM Technologies Trading Down 0.4 %

Shares of NASDAQ:TTMI traded down $0.08 during trading on Tuesday, reaching $18.17. The stock had a trading volume of 302,710 shares, compared to its average volume of 777,049. The firm's fifty day moving average is $18.90 and its 200 day moving average is $17.96. The company has a debt-to-equity ratio of 0.60, a quick ratio of 1.74 and a current ratio of 2.04. TTM Technologies, Inc. has a 52 week low of $11.14 and a 52 week high of $22.70. The stock has a market cap of $1.85 billion, a price-to-earnings ratio of -912.50 and a beta of 1.26.

TTM Technologies (NASDAQ:TTMI - Get Free Report) last released its quarterly earnings data on Wednesday, July 31st. The technology company reported $0.39 earnings per share for the quarter, topping the consensus estimate of $0.34 by $0.05. The firm had revenue of $605.10 million for the quarter, compared to the consensus estimate of $582.70 million. TTM Technologies had a net margin of 0.74% and a return on equity of 9.01%. The business's revenue was up 10.7% on a year-over-year basis. During the same quarter in the prior year, the company posted $0.28 earnings per share. As a group, equities analysts forecast that TTM Technologies, Inc. will post 1.31 EPS for the current fiscal year.

TTM Technologies Profile

(Free Report)

TTM Technologies, Inc, together with its subsidiaries, manufactures and sells mission systems, radio frequency (RF) components and RF microwave/microelectronic assemblies, and printed circuit boards (PCB) worldwide. The company operates in two segments, PCB and RF&S Components. It offers range of engineered systems, RF and microwave assemblies, HDI PCBs, flexible PCBs, rigid-flex PCBs, custom assemblies and system integration, IC substrates, passive RF components, advanced ceramic RF components, hi-reliability multi-chip modules, beamforming and switching networks, PCB products, RF components, and backplane/custom assembly solutions, including conventional PCBs.
